It's usually a good idea to ask another maintainer or reviewer before doing it, but have the courage to do it when you believe it is important. +- In the interest of [Iteration](https://about.gitlab.com/handbook/values/#iteration), + if, as a reviewer, your suggestions are non-blocking changes or personal preference + (not a documented or agreed requirement), consider approving the merge request + before passing it back to the author. This allows them to implement your suggestions + if they agree, or allows them to pass it onto the + maintainer for review straight away. This can help reduce our overall time-to-merge. - There is a difference in doing things right and doing things right now.
